Address

13jM2B6dfRdVZYEBb8ba7xWBrgPL3CbJy9
Confirmed tx count
32
Confirmed received
16 outputs (1.14746000 BTC)
Confirmed spent
16 outputs (1.14746000 BTC)
Confirmed unspent
No outputs

25 of 32 Transactions